Dentro de um contêiner LXC, você não pode executar o NFS porque ele é baseado no kernel (por exemplo, ele só será executado no host). UNFS e outros servidores NFS do espaço do usuário são uma opção.
Eu tentei seguir estas instruções para configurar o servidor NFS no 12.04:
https://help.ubuntu.com/community/SettingUpNFSHowTo
/etc/default/portmap
não existe, então eu pulei essa parte.
Depois de editar /etc/exports
, tentei reiniciar / iniciar o serviço NFS, mas recebo o seguinte erro que não entendi, tudo foi instalado a partir do apt-get:
davidparks21@hadoop-fsimage-bkup1:~$ sudo service nfs-kernel-server start
FATAL: Could not load /lib/modules/3.5.0-27-generic/modules.dep: No such file or directory
* Not starting NFS kernel daemon: no support in current kernel.
Eu devo observar strongmente que este é um contêiner 12.04 LXC que está sendo executado em um host 12.10!
Atualização: testado em um contêiner 12.10 LXC e recebo o mesmo erro.
Dentro de um contêiner LXC, você não pode executar o NFS porque ele é baseado no kernel (por exemplo, ele só será executado no host). UNFS e outros servidores NFS do espaço do usuário são uma opção.